The PM8851 device is a high frequency single channel low-side MOSFET driver specifically designed to work with digital power conversion microcontrollers, such as the STMicroelectronics STLUX™ family of products.
The PM8851 has complementary output pins to differentiate sink and source driving with a current capability of respectively 1 A and 0.8 A.
The input levels of the driver are derived by the voltage present at the IN_TH pin (between 2 V and 5.5 V). This pin is typically connected at the same voltage of the microcontroller supply voltage.
The PM8851 includes both input and output pull-down resistors.

- Low-side MOSFET driver
- 1 A sink and 0.8 A source capability
- Complementary outputs for source and sink driving
- Ext. reference for input threshold
- Wide supply voltage range (10 V ÷ 18 V)
- Input and output pull-down resistors
- Short propagation delays
- Input and output UVLO
- Wide operating temperature range: -40 °C to 125 °C
- SOT23-6L package
